Multiple Choice
If a particular gene is located on the Z chromosome in a species with ZW sex determination (such as birds), which of the following statements is correct?
A
Both males and females have the same number of copies of the gene.
B
Females (ZW) have two copies of the gene, while males (ZZ) have only one copy.
C
Males (ZZ) have two copies of the gene, while females (ZW) have only one copy.
D
The gene is only expressed in females.

Understand the ZW sex determination system: In species with ZW sex determination, females have ZW chromosomes and males have ZZ chromosomes.
Identify the location of the gene: The gene is located on the Z chromosome, which means it is present on the Z chromosome(s) but not on the W chromosome.
Determine the number of gene copies in males: Since males are ZZ, they have two Z chromosomes, so they have two copies of the gene.
Determine the number of gene copies in females: Since females are ZW, they have only one Z chromosome, so they have only one copy of the gene.
Conclude which statement is correct based on the above: Males (ZZ) have two copies of the gene, while females (ZW) have only one copy.
